Best Wilson Public Schools (2026)

For the 2026 school year, there are 2 public schools serving 970 students in Wilson, NY.
The top-ranked public schools in Wilson, NY are Wilson Elementary School and Wilson Middle/high School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Wilson, NY public schools have an average math proficiency score of 57% (versus the New York public school average of 53%), and reading proficiency score of 40% (versus the 49% statewide average). Schools in Wilson have an average ranking of 5/10, which is in the bottom 50% of New York public schools.
Minority enrollment is 12%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the New York public school average of 61% (majority Hispanic).
